Output 24564925b07f3506b102bfa617c8ade10d45eae6be9f0e01868055d5d1ac972c:75

value
987408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f30a2b2c3b8e45135edf47dca65454f1a9db68 OP_EQUALVERIFY OP_CHECKSIG
address
18P2D3TLKiTQp2DfLBdSxNsgw75QnB4J4q
transaction
24564925b07f3506b102bfa617c8ade10d45eae6be9f0e01868055d5d1ac972c
spent
true